自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 资源 (1)
  • 收藏
  • 关注

原创 RK3568 Android11 双屏异触

本文摘要:探讨Android系统中双触摸屏(TP)的配置方法。通过分析InputDeviceIdentifier结构体,详细说明了设备标识符的组成,包括设备名称、位置信息、厂商ID等关键字段。同时提供了ADB调试命令示例,展示如何获取设备标识符信息,为双TP设备的主副屏识别与配置提供技术参考。该方案适用于需要区分多个输入设备的场景,确保系统能正确处理来自不同触摸屏的输入信号。

2026-01-22 09:59:03 196

原创 Linux Device Demo

本文摘要: 该代码实现了一个基于Linux内核的设备驱动框架,主要用于管理GPIO端口和控制设备电源状态。驱动支持通过设备树配置GPIO引脚,包括电源控制GPIO、按键GPIO和中断GPIO。关键功能包括:1) 通过sysfs接口控制设备电源开关;2) 支持中断处理实现按键检测;3) 提供定时器功能处理按键事件。驱动采用模块化设计,兼容设备树配置,实现了基本的输入设备功能,可将GPIO状态变化映射为输入事件上报给系统。

2026-01-21 17:55:44 631

原创 Linux错误返回值一览

本文摘要:Linux系统错误返回值分为两部分定义。第一部分(1-34)在errno-base.h中定义基础错误,如EPERM(操作不允许)、ENOENT(文件不存在)等。第二部分(35-133)在errno.h中扩展定义,包含EDEADLK(死锁)、ENOSYS(无效系统调用)等高级错误。文件使用宏定义方式声明错误代码及其描述,部分错误码存在别名关系(如EWOULDBLOCK与EAGAIN)。这些错误代码用于标识系统调用和文件操作中的各种异常情况。

2026-01-21 17:30:13 387

原创 MTK TP调试记录

文章摘要:本文记录了MT6739平台上GT1151Q触摸屏驱动的调试过程。重点内容包括:1)IIC地址配置注意事项,需右移一位去除读写位;2)多路径下的硬件配置方法,涉及IO配置、DTS添加和宏定义修改;3)关键结构体配置,如i2c_driver和tpd_driver_t的定义;4)驱动加载流程,包括DTS信息获取和驱动注册。调试过程涵盖了从硬件接口到软件驱动的完整配置链,为MTK平台触摸屏驱动开发提供了详细参考。

2026-01-21 17:28:03 534

原创 MTK LCM调试记录

本文记录了MT6739平台LCD显示屏(LCM)的调试过程,主要包括硬件配置和驱动开发两部分。在硬件配置方面,详细说明了IO口配置路径、设备树(dts)修改方法以及相关宏定义的添加。驱动开发部分重点介绍了初始化命令的配置、LCM参数结构体的设置(包括分辨率、数据格式、时序参数等)以及ID匹配验证流程。调试过程涉及内核层(kernel)和引导层(LK)的双重配置,通过修改多个配置文件实现了显示屏的正常驱动和控制。

2026-01-21 17:26:01 139

原创 开发者常用命令

本文提供了Windows、Linux、Git和ADB的常用命令参考手册。Windows快捷命令包括命令窗指令、文件资源管理器地址栏命令、CMD/PowerShell常用命令、快捷键组合和高级工具命令,涵盖了系统配置、网络管理、文件操作等功能。Linux常用命令分为文件与目录操作、文件权限与所有权、系统信息与管理三部分,详细列出了文件管理、权限设置、系统信息查询等操作。这些命令经过整理和优化,适合作为日常使用的参考手册,帮助用户快速完成系统管理和文件操作任务。

2025-05-23 10:43:54 911

原创 MTK驱动开发

本文主要介绍了MTK驱动开发中的编译、驱动函数、驱动配置等内容。在编译部分,详细说明了如何查看编译版本、Android 14平台的编译脚本命令、烧录路径以及.mk文件的调用方式。驱动函数部分涵盖了模块加载、中断唤醒、模块外可调用声明等内容,并对比了不同初始化函数的优缺点。驱动配置部分则介绍了如何关闭控制台服务、内核层log打印、user版打开串口log、屏蔽开机log、camera、LCM、TP、Audio、兼容字库调试以及GPIO的dws配置工具。这些内容为MTK驱动开发提供了实用的技术指导和操作步骤。

2025-05-23 10:38:27 1383

原创 Linux系统 命令

git clone git@192.168.0.190:/git/6739-o.git [目录名] //拉取masete分支git clone git@192.168.0.190:/git/6739-o.git -b [远程分支名] [目录名] //拉取指定分支到指定。

2023-03-31 18:31:05 149 1

MTK 电池曲线调试工具

MTK 电池曲线调试工具

2025-05-16

GT1151-Datesheet

触摸屏IC GT1151-Datesheet

2024-10-25

TSPL指令集中文和英文资料.zip

tspl命令集

2022-01-10

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除